We just returned from our first time at The Verandah Resort and had a wonderful time. We were quite concerned as we read several medicore reviews just before our arrival. I would not agree with most of what I've read. They're still building and working on improvement but none of it interferred with our stay. The grounds were amazing. Well landscaped and lush. I'm sure in a few months it will even be better. They're building a new restaurant on the premises and another "adult only" pool. The staff was very friendly and couldn't do enough for you. Constantly asking if we were having fun and was there anything they could do to make it better.
The food was better than average for "all inclusive." There were so many great staff it's hard to remember all of them. But hats off to Tyrone (server), Jodi (watersports) Felisia (bar) and the duty managers we met. They were always available. The rooms were spacious and comfortable with a great balcony overlooking the bay. Yes, there were some homes across the bay being repaired or closed but nothing that bothered our view. Watersports were plentiful and activities were always available. We took part in a couples kayak race were they gave out a bottle of wine to the winner. Paddle boats, Hobie cats and kayaks were plentiful. They have walking tours to Devil's Bridge which is a top "tourist" spot and Long Bay beach was also nearby. The taxi rides were pricey on their own and often included in whatever excursion you chose to do. The tour desk was available to book trips each day. We went horseback riding on two lovely beaches. We made arrangements with a local to tour all the hotspots on the island for a full 4.5 hours for a reasonable fee. I'm sure this was added money in his pocket but we had a great day and enjoyed learning all about the island from someone who grew up there. The weather was perfect, warm and breezy (sometimes a light sweater is necessary in the evenings). Great entertainment in the evenings yet we didn't see alot of it as we're early birds and tend to turn in early and get up early in the morning. The spa was awesome and the gym was complete with fresh towels and a water cooler and new equipment.
The service charge of $25 at Nicole's is being waived until May. The restaurants were not open every evening but almost always 2 of the 3 restaurants were open. Although Nicole's is a bit more upscale than the other two restaurants I wouldn't consider the $25 service charge as "worth it". It was a more elegant spot with very attentive service. The food was good but not worth an additional $50 per couple. They may have to add something more to make it worth the extra surcharge.
All in all we had a great time and would recommend it to everyone. I do think it is a very "family" oriented resort but it didn't bother us. We requested (prior to arrival) to be placed in a "adults only" unit to be sure to have more peace and quiet next door to us. We're in our early 50's and would consider returning in the future.
